A hernia is the protrusion of an organ or tissue through a weakness or abnormal opening in the wall of the cavity that normally contains it. While many hernias occur in the lower abdomen or groin, certain types and sizes can impact a person’s ability to breathe comfortably. Respiratory symptoms typically result from direct anatomical interference with the diaphragm or complications arising from the displacement of abdominal contents. Understanding the specific mechanism is helpful because treatment varies significantly based on the hernia’s location and size.
Hiatal Hernias and Direct Respiratory Symptoms
A hiatal hernia occurs when the upper part of the stomach pushes upward through the hiatus, the opening in the diaphragm through which the esophagus passes. The diaphragm is the primary muscle responsible for breathing, separating the chest cavity from the abdomen. When a portion of the stomach is displaced into the chest, it mechanically interferes with the full downward movement of the diaphragm during inhalation, potentially leading to shortness of breath.
This type of hernia is associated with gastroesophageal reflux disease (GERD) because the displacement compromises the lower esophageal sphincter. Severe acid reflux can trigger a neurogenic response, where irritation of the esophageal lining causes the airways to constrict, mimicking asthma. This mechanism can lead to chronic coughing, hoarseness, and wheezing, especially when lying down.
In more serious cases, refluxed stomach contents can be inhaled directly into the lungs, a condition known as aspiration. Aspiration introduces foreign material that irritates the airways, resulting in recurrent pulmonary infections or asthma-like symptoms. Dyspnea, or breathlessness, is a common symptom with large hiatal hernias, sometimes due to silent aspiration or compression of the heart and lungs.
How Large Abdominal Hernias Restrict Lung Capacity
Large abdominal wall hernias, such as incisional or ventral hernias, impair breathing through a different mechanical process. These hernias can grow massive, a condition sometimes called “loss of domain,” where a significant volume of abdominal organs resides outside the abdominal cavity. As contents herniate outward, the abdominal wall loses containment, and the abdominal cavity shrinks over time.
This situation indirectly affects respiration by pushing the diaphragm upward from below, reducing the space available for the lungs to expand. The result is a restrictive breathing pattern, decreasing the total volume of air the lungs can hold. For patients with very large hernias, this upward pressure can cause paradoxical respiratory motion, where the abdomen moves inward during inhalation, further compromising lung function.
Repairing a large hernia can temporarily increase intra-abdominal pressure when the contents are returned to the cavity, which may initially impair breathing further. Pre-operative techniques like progressive pneumoperitoneum are sometimes used to gently stretch the abdominal wall and prepare the respiratory system for this change. The goal of repair is to restore the abdominal wall and improve long-term pulmonary function by allowing the diaphragm to return to its proper position.
Warning Signs and When to Seek Emergency Care
While many hernia-related breathing issues are chronic, acute changes can signal a life-threatening medical emergency. Two serious complications, incarceration and strangulation, require immediate medical attention, especially if respiratory distress is present. An incarcerated hernia occurs when the herniated tissue becomes trapped and cannot be pushed back into the abdominal cavity, causing severe pain and swelling.
Strangulation is a progression of incarceration where the blood supply to the trapped tissue, often a loop of intestine, is cut off. This process leads to tissue death, resulting in gangrene, sepsis, and a potentially fatal infection. Respiratory symptoms in this context are alarming because they may indicate the body is going into shock or struggling against systemic infection.
Seek immediate emergency care if new or worsening shortness of breath is coupled with sudden, excruciating pain at the hernia site. Other urgent warning signs include:
- The inability to pass gas or have a bowel movement.
- Persistent nausea and vomiting.
- Visible color changes in the skin over the hernia, which may turn reddish or darker.
- A fever or a rapid heart rate, indicating severe distress or infection.
